Fort Washakie is a small village located in a remote area of Wyoming, so home ownership in this area does have some unique pros and cons.

Pros:

1. Affordability: Home prices in Fort Washakie are generally more affordable compared to other areas in the country. This could make it easier for first-time homebuyers to enter the market.

2. Scenic Beauty: The village is surrounded by the beautiful Wind River Range, which is a paradise for outdoor enthusiasts, hikers, and anglers. This makes it an excellent place to own a home if you enjoy nature and the outdoors.

3. Low Crime Rate: Fort Washakie has a low crime rate compared to other areas, making it a safe place to live.

Cons:

1. Limited Job Opportunities: Fort Washakie is a small village with a limited number of employment opportunities. This means that unless you work remotely or are self-employed, you may have a hard time finding a job that pays well enough to meet your needs.

2. Severe Winters: The winters in Fort Washakie can be severe, with snow and ice storms causing travel difficulties and making it difficult to get around.

3. Rural Isolation: Fort Washakie is quite remote, and this can lead to feelings of isolation and lack of community resources.

Overall, owning a home in Fort Washakie can be a good idea if you enjoy the rural lifestyle, outdoor activities, and value an affordable cost of living. However, it's important to weigh the pros and cons carefully before making any decisions about where to own a home.
